Transaction 7021f310196079754f075c0a098f918a59375bb3606f3ec8b799e0b5f61a8b8d

1 Input
2 Outputs
  • 7021f310196079754f075c0a098f918a59375bb3606f3ec8b799e0b5f61a8b8d:0
  • value  530923
    address  3Q51v76emKybyNpL3eS3iv75w8wvJkrLS1
  • 7021f310196079754f075c0a098f918a59375bb3606f3ec8b799e0b5f61a8b8d:1
  • value  201404806
    address  383cajdpU3V1F3WPxG3qJbmU7ivfrLieYn